Where can I read basic books online for free?

4 Answers2025-07-15 17:34:16
I’ve got a treasure trove of sites to share. Project Gutenberg is my go-to—it’s packed with over 60,000 free eBooks, mostly classics like 'Pride and Prejudice' and 'Frankenstein,' all legal and easy to download. Open Library is another gem; it lets you borrow modern books digitally, almost like a virtual library. For contemporary titles, ManyBooks offers a mix of classics and indie works with a sleek interface. If you’re into niche genres, Scribd’s free trial gives temporary access to tons of books, though you’ll need a subscription later. Websites like LibriVox are perfect for audiobook lovers, with volunteers narrating public-domain books. Don’t overlook your local library’s digital services either—apps like Libby or Hoopla let you borrow eBooks for free with a library card. Just remember to check copyrights; some sites host pirated content, which I avoid supporting.

Is Basic Mathematics by Lang available as an audiobook?

2 Answers2025-07-04 14:06:37
it's been a frustrating journey. As someone who absorbs math better through listening, I was really hoping to find it. After scouring Audible, Google Play Books, and even niche academic platforms, I hit dead ends. The book’s structure—heavy on exercises and proofs—might explain why it hasn’t gotten the audiobook treatment. Visual learners thrive on its clarity, but translating that to audio would require massive adaptation, like reworking diagrams into verbal descriptions. That said, I stumbled upon podcasts and YouTube lectures covering similar topics, which helped fill the gap. Lang’s prose is precise, but without his signature problem sets, an audiobook might lose its essence. If you’re desperate for audio learning, try pairing conceptual podcasts with a physical copy for exercises. It’s not ideal, but it’s the closest workaround I’ve found.
